Just how Often Should You Take Your Canine To The Vet in Bamber Bridge UK?

Generally, if you have a healthy and balanced canine, it would only require to see you local Bamber Bridge veterinarian a minimum of once a year for a general examination. It is fairly different for brand-new pups and also older canines.

New young puppies will require several visits to the veterinarian in their first 6 months. They will certainly need to check up with the veterinarian for their initial exam, pup vaccinations, heartworm (plus flea and tick) prevention, as well as for neutering. Whilst, senior pets over 7 years will certainly need at the very least 2 examinations per year.

What Are The Different Kinds of Vets in Bamber Bridge UK?

Put simply, a vet is basically an animal physician. There are many types of vets in Bamber Bridge UK however listed below are the 5 major kinds of veterinarians.

Companion pet veterinarians: Veterinarians that work with companion pets like dogs and cats.

Livestock vets: Veterinarians who deal with tamed stock.

Exotic animal veterinarians: Vets that typically deal with reptiles, birds as well as tiny creatures like rats as well as ferrets.

Mixed practice veterinarians: Vets who work with both small as well as large pets.

Lab animal medicine vets: Vets that work in laboratories that are responsible for the wellness of a variety of animals on account of science.

Microchipping Pet Dogs and Pet Cats

Microchipping of pet cats and canines involve injecting a little microchip with an unique code that is linked to a Animal ID Register. Microchip for family pets are securely implanted under your family pet’s skin. If your animal were to go missing, a local government ranger for Bamber Bridge or Bamber Bridge veterinarian will have the ability to check your pet’s microchip and gain access to your contact info to connect with you.

Feline and Dog Dental Cleaning and Examinations

Regular dental cleaning and also check-ups on your pet cats and also pets will assist to acknowledge any indications of oral disease and will allow your Bamber Bridge veterinarian to discuss what dental monitoring program would be best for your cat or dog. Usual signs of oral disease in canines and felines consist of halitosis, loosened teeth, discoloured teeth, face swelling, extreme salivating and extra. If your feline or pet has any one of these signs, you ought to schedule for a cat or pet dog dental cleaning and exams at your neighborhood Bamber Bridge veterinarian center.
